During the second day of the 57th Swedish Rally, Dani Sordo/Marc Martí and their Citroën C4 WRC made a spectacular comeback in the standings. Starting 18th this morning, they are now ranked 7th, in a good position to bring four ‘Constructors’ points to Citroën. In the second car of the Citroën Total team, Sébastien Loeb/Daniel Elena set two best times before withdrawing due to an engine problem following their off-road excursion yesterday.
During this second day of racing around Hagfors, the teams encountered more familiar stages than those on Friday. The 121 kilometers against the clock were divided into a group of three special stages to be contested twice, including Vargäsen (SS11/14), where the famous “Colin Crest” is located, a bump so named after a spectacular jump by the late Colin McRae. Due to the thaw, the organizers were forced to cancel SS12, which was heavily degraded after the first round.
In very non-wintery conditions (6°C), the thin layer of ice covering the roads disappeared after a few cars passed, revealing the ground beneath. On this soft surface, where the studs couldn’t grip, it was difficult for the Pirelli Sottozero tires to perform fully. “These are the worst conditions one can find in Sweden,” summarized Dani Sordo. “The grip is constantly changing. You can’t predict if you’re going to be driving on ice or earth… and the snow walls aren’t there to stop us! You have to stay on the defensive.” The Citroën teams showed the most skill during the morning, winning all the stages and affirming the C4’s qualities on this challenging terrain.
« I was more familiar with today’s challenges. I immediately got off to a good start.
rhythm, continued Dani. My driving on this slippery surface keeps improving and I am satisfied with my performance. The behavior of my C4 WRC on these very degraded roads gave me complete satisfaction. I hope my position will improve further to score more points for Citroën.
Restarting in SupeRally after their mistake the previous day, Sébastien Loeb and Daniel Elena managed a good start to the day: « In this situation, it is tricky to know which tactic to adopt », said Seb. « We tried to drive fast to stay focused. Things went well until the service, then we decided not to continue because our engine had suffered too much in our exit from SS4. »
« Our Saturday report is positive », stated Olivier Quesnel. « Our teams perfectly managed to avoid the numerous traps, and our Citroën C4 WRC proved effective. Dani and Marc had to try to improve their position. By gaining 11 places, they superbly achieved this objective. There are 97 kilometers of special stages left tomorrow, and they could still progress in the standings. For Seb and Daniel, the engine of their car showed signs of weakness, probably due to their off-road incident yesterday. We preferred to stop them. »
